Guide G59/G99 Fast Track for Storage. A G59/G99 fast-track application process has been developed for single phase installations that comprise ER G83/G98 compliant generation (e.g. solar PV) rated up to 16A and ER G83/G98 compliant energy storage rated up to 16A fitted with an ER G100 compliant Export Limitation Scheme that restricts the export to 16A per phase or less.

Grid energy storage, also known as large-scale energy storage, are technologies connected to the electrical power grid that store energy for later use. These systems help balance supply and demand by storing excess electricity from variable renewables such as solar and inflexible sources like nuclear power, releasing it when needed.

In distributed arrangements, the energy storage systems are connected via individual power electronic interfaces to each RES. In this method, each storage system has responsibility for the control and optimization of the power output of the source to which it is connected, , .
